Having been asked to DJ at the New venue in a couple of weeks time thought I should show my face and have a dance. As it was teeming down with rain I did not expect a large crowd!!

The venue is only in its second week and how refreshing to have a majority of begineers. And what a nice crowd. Not afraid, even in the second week to tap people up for a dance. (we need begineers). And the support of many of the regular yorkshire dancers to balance up the evening was great.

I didn't get to sit down all night and as an unfit DJ am I paying the price today

Nice set from young DJ Charlie and good quality teaching from Jodie and demonstrator Richard. This is going to be a great success which is credit to Ann and Robs hard work in getting it going. I am looking forward to the 31st may and 7th June when I get to spin the discs.

Wednesdays, Queens hall, Leeds. Great Dance floor and plenty of room. Bar with friendly staff that were genuinly interested in the customers (thats a novelty). And all important - Its a nice area of Leeds with no fear of car damage etc.
